26146999452013440 is an even composite number. It is composed of eight dist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of three thousand and seventy-two divisors.

Prime factorization of 26146999452013440:

27 × 3 × 5 × 73 × 11 × 13 × 312 × 288913

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 5 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 11 × 13 × 31 × 31 × 288913)
